信息命令行实现快速获取Redis信息(命令行获取redis)
信息命令行实现:快速获取Redis信息
Redis是 用C语言开发的key-value形式的NoSQL数据库,在众多项目中用来作为缓存,而且它支持超高并发、方便快捷。但它也有一定的使用门槛,使用起来确实有点麻烦,正常通过控制台操作Redis有可能比较累,好在现在有一种方法可以快速的获取相关的Redis信息,那就是使用命令行实现。
要快速获取Redis信息,需要先安装Redis客户端,比如redis-cli和Hiredis。这些客户端根据你使用的操作系统和版本进行安装。之后,就可以使用以下命令来获取Redis信息:
1. 获取Redis服务器状态:使用info命令获取Redis实例运行情况,包括Server和Clients信息等,如:
redis-cli -h 127.0.0.1 -p 6379 info
2. 获取Redis服务器监控信息:可以使用Monitor命令来实时监控Redis实例,这可以提供快速的实时debug的功能,如:
redis-cli -h 192.168.1.1 -p 6379 monitor
3. 获取Redis key的基本信息:使用ttl命令可以快速判断Redis key的存活时间,使用randomkey命令可以随机获取一个key,使用exists检查key是否存在,如:
redis-cli -h 192.168.1.1 -p 6379 ttl key_name
redis-cli -h 192.168.1.1 -p 6379 randomkey
redis-cli -h 192.168.1.1 -p 6379 exists key_name
综上所述,在熟悉命令行脚本语言后,可以节省大量的手动操作时间,从而快速运行Redis实例,获取相关信息,加快开发效率。